FOI-S-007 rev 2.0

Optical Safety at Work

International references: IEC 60825-1/-2

1. Scope

Mandatory safety requirements for all personnel performing fiber work under institute certification.

2. Normative requirements

2.1 No person shall view a fiber end, connector or port directly. Verification of the dark state shall be by optical power meter; endface viewing shall use indirect video instruments only.
2.2 Every fiber shall be treated as energized until measured dark. On amplified or PON systems, work shall follow a written method-of-procedure including notification and, where applicable, automatic power reduction confirmation.
2.3 Cleaved fiber offcuts shall be collected immediately into a dedicated sharps container; work shall be performed over a contrasting mat; eating and drinking are prohibited at the fiber work position.
2.4 Solvent use follows fire precautions; no splicer arc shall be struck in a chamber or vault before atmosphere testing. Confined-space, work-at-height and traffic-control activities follow the site permit system without exception.
2.5 Incidents and near-misses involving optical exposure or glass injury shall be reported within 24 hours to the responsible supervisor.

3. Acceptance criteria

Site audits verify compliance by observation and records; two or more critical findings suspend certified status for the crew pending retraining.
